Shooting sports is one of the fastest-growing program areas in Maine and is a new approach that offers a fully comprehensive shooting experience! Campers will now have the opportunity to learn 5 different shooting disciplines: Archery, Rifle, Shotgun, Muzzleloader (Black-powder), and Pistol. Each day will have a different focus, offering the most in-depth shooting experience we’ve ever offered at Bryant Pond.

No previous shooting experience is required.

The program will also include outdoor skills, swimming, hiking, and other traditional camp activities.

Because The University of Maine defines firearms and archery equipment as weapons and has a strict weapons policy for the safety of all, and for liability and insurance reasons, camp program participants are asked not to bring their personal shooting sports equipment to Bryant Pond 4-H Camp & Learning Center without prior authorization from the Camp Director or the Maine 4-H Shooting Sports Program Coordinator. The 4-H Shooting Sports instruction team at Bryant Pond is very familiar with the wide variety of equipment here, and competently provides complete instruction in the shooting sports discipline programs that we offer.
